Job Description:


AECOM's Wellington Civil Infrastructure team is recruiting a Principal level Geotechnical Engineer to contribute to the success of our Ground Engineering team.


Work with and support colleagues locally, nationally, and globally working across a variety of engineering and environmental disciplines to produce high quality outcomes for our clients and contribute to the continued growth of the team.


Our Ground Engineering team provides one-stop access to services ranging from project management, feasibility studies, initial inspections, detailed design, contract administration and construction supervision for geotechnical works.


We are looking for an ambitious team player to assist in the development of innovative, cost effective and buildable solutions in an environment that is collaborative, stimulating and fast paced.


Your extensive geotechnical consultancy experience, strong capability in geotechnical studies, investigation, and design for road earthworks, slip management and remediation, bridge foundations, retaining structures and strengthened earthworks will add to our teams existing strengths.


The Wellington Region is a dynamic environment, and you provide a leadership role in the in the delivery of significant resilience projects for our local council clients such as the Ngaio Gorge Stabilization works in Wellington, the Eastern Hutt Road stabilisation design in Hutt City, and our growing portfolio of work with Wellington International Airport.


Nationally you would support our team in the provision of ground engineering services for projects such as the Central Interceptor wastewater tunnel, the Supporting Growth Alliance, our growing portfolio with KiwiRail, new medical facilities for our DHB clients, and nationally significant power transmission infrastructure.


Qualifications:

M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:

- +10 years' experience in a multidisciplinary environment

  • Proven track record in studies, investigations and geotechnical design for new build transportation and infrastructure
  • Possess strong problem solving and interpersonal skills
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ills; the ability to write clear and concise technical reports is essential.
  • In depth knowledge and experience of relevant design standards.
  • Experience in routinely used geotechnical software including Leapfrog, gINT, Slope/W, SLIDE and Plaxis, GIS or Geospatial skills desirable.
  • Well versed in a variety of ground conditions and of soil and rock design parameter selection; local knowledge is advantageous.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Degree in Geotechnical Engineering (CPEng preferable)
